MFG 201 ADVANCED CAD MODEL MAKING AND TOOLING


3 Units 2 hours lecture 3 hours lab
Prerequisite: MFG 200
Recommended Preparation: ARCH/DR 50 and MFG 204
A comprehensive study of rapid prototyping (RP), additive manufacturing tooling, and secondary processes. Includes stereo lithography (SLA), fused deposition modeling (FDM), three dimensional printing (3DP), and multi-jet modeling (MJM) machine operations. Students apply advanced materials secondary processes and finishing for RP models, resin casting, vacuum forming, silicone mold making and composites. Activities include finishing on several rapid prototyping machines and secondary processing equipment. Magics RP will be used for tool creation and repair of STL files.
